  • We decided to ls swap our jet boat and take it to the lake this past weekend the engine mounts where already in and headers were finished but we yanked the built engine for a junkyard 5.3 that was complete.
    Headers were built by Danny Giannini @dgiannini dgiannini?...
    Valve Covers Part #241-408
    Fuel Pump Part# 12-800
    Fuel Filter PART# 162-550
    Fuel Regulator Part# 12-848
    we highly
    recommend running a Terminator EFI control system and make sure you chose the correct one depending on engine
    CP performance PTO driveshaft
    ICT billet water pump Relocation lines SKU 551536
